[ARCHIVE]Toute question de débutant, afin de ne pas encombrer le forum. Professionnels, ne passez pas à côté. Je ne peux aller nulle part sans toi - 5. - page 392

 
Integer:

En gros, c'est très bien :) Pas tellement normal ou pas normal, ça fait ça et c'est tout. Regardez ce qu'il dit, si des messages d'erreur, il est nécessaire de prendre certaines mesures avec ces erreurs. S'il y a des messages d'information, vous devez les désactiver (s'il y a un commutateur) ou commenter les fonctions Print()(), Comment(), Alert().
Ouvrir un fichier txt de la taille de l'hygiène est la mort de l'ordinateur. Il se fige pendant une heure ! Les journaux sont ce qui est écrit dans le journal de bord, non ?
 
Bonjour aux utilisateurs du forum. J'ai besoin d'un indicateur qui dessine les prix de clôture du jour pendant 1 à 2 semaines avec une simple ligne le long du graphique. Si vous pouviez définir le nombre de jours dans les paramètres, ce serait génial.
 
Mishka29:
Bonjour aux utilisateurs du forum. J'ai besoin d'un indicateur qui dessine les prix de clôture pour 1-2 semaines avec une simple ligne le long du graphique, il serait possible de définir le nombre de jours dans les paramètres, ce serait génial.
30 dollars et... Oh, mon Dieu ! ... C'est à vous ! Ou commencez à l'écrire vous-même, et nous vous dirons ce qui ne va pas, et ce qui n'est pas clair ...
 
J'ai misé sur l'euro-dollar hier pour le vendre aujourd'hui - 500 $. Pensez-vous qu'il a une chance de tomber ? Cela fermerait au moins pas avec un si grand moins ?
 
lottamer:
Si j'ouvre un fichier txt aussi gros que l'hygiène, cela sera fatal pour mon ordinateur. Il se bloquera pendant une heure ! les logs sont ce qui est écrit dans le journal de bord ? et vous devez regarder le journal de bord dans le terminal, non ?

Ouvrez les journaux longs dans un éditeur normal. Dans UltraEdit, par exemple. Le Bloc-notes n'aime pas les gros fichiers.

Chiripaha:

1. Le tutoriel de Sergey Kovalev décrit une méthode avec optimisation de l'espace, dans laquelle le conseiller expert travaillera en boucle. Si nous considérons ceci et le multithreading, ai-je raison de supposer que cette nature cyclique de l'EA ne causera pas de désavantage aux autres EA, scripts ou indicateurs ? Et nous pouvons sans risque commencer le travail de l'EA en boucle ? Ou serait-il préférable de ne pas le faire ? Et quand est-il préférable de l'éviter ?

2. D'après ce que je comprends, cette fonctionnalité de bouclage est mise en œuvre dans le code ci-dessus. C'est probablement pour ça que je m'en suis souvenu.

À propos, si nous exécutons un tel conseiller expert cyclique dans le testeur, dans quelle mesure sera-t-il correct ? Ou bien la boucle doit-elle être "désactivée" dans ce cas ?

1. Tout fonctionne bien. La boucle est nécessaire pour pouvoir travailler, par exemple, sur d'autres symboles ou pour faire autre chose (maintenance de l'interface). Sans la boucle, le conseiller expert ne se déclenche que sur les ticks du graphique où il est chargé.
2. Il s'agit d'un script de démonstration. La boucle est nécessaire pour vérifier la capacité de travail pendant le week-end.

3. il fonctionnera.

 
Monluk:
J'ai pris part à une vente à découvert hier sur l'euro dollar aujourd'hui - 500 $. Pensez-vous qu'il a une chance de tomber ? Cela fermerait au moins pas avec un si grand moins.

Il est plus approprié de poser cette question dans un forum de milliardaires. Le forum actuel pour la programmation en MQL.

Le trading est un environnement probabiliste. Par conséquent, la probabilité, c'est-à-dire la chance, est toujours dans les deux sens en même temps. La probabilité la plus élevée du résultat le plus probable est de 85 % (selon certaines études). Mais comment et ce qui va réellement se passer sur le marché, c'est quelque chose que même les teneurs de marché ne savent pas toujours.

 
Profitov:

Il suffit de redémarrer le terminal ou de télécharger manuellement les guillemets dans le regard des paramètres.
J'ai téléchargé un nouveau terminal, c'est le seul moyen d'y arriver ! Et c'est la faute des volumes, ils accumulent toujours des erreurs ! A quoi servent-ils s'ils ne reflètent pas les volumes réels ? Vous n'en avez pas besoin, vous avez besoin d'autres choses, mais je vais me taire à ce sujet, on m'a appris...
 

Bonjour à tous !

Essayer de coder une idée simple

Si l'heure d'ouverture de la bougie zéro est le 14.08.2000 14.00'.

Ouvrez un ordre de marché à l'UN des prix qui se trouve à l'intérieur de cette bougie.

Mais la commande ne s'ouvre pas pour une raison quelconque.

S'il vous plaît, dites-moi où je me trompe.

Je ne suis pas sûr de ce qu'il faut faire.

int start()
 {
 double Price=0.9022; 
 if  ((iOpen (Symbol (),0,0))== D'14.08.2000 14 00')
 if (Bid == Price)

 int Ticket= OrderSend(Symbol(),OP_SELL,0.1,Bid,1,Ask+1490*Point,Ask-110*Point,"jfh",123 );
}
return(0);
 
solnce600:

Bonjour à tous !

Essayer de coder une idée simple

Si l'heure d'ouverture de la bougie zéro est le 14.08.2000 14.00'.

Ouvrez un ordre de marché à l'UN des prix qui se trouve à l'intérieur de cette bougie.

Mais la commande ne s'ouvre pas pour une raison quelconque.

S'il vous plaît, dites-moi où je me trompe.

Merci.

Vous comparez le prix avec le temps :

if  ((iOpen (Symbol (),0,0))== D'14.08.2000 14 00')
 
Zhunko:

1. Tout fonctionne bien. La boucle est nécessaire pour pouvoir travailler, par exemple, sur d'autres symboles ou pour faire autre chose (maintenance de l'interface). Sans la boucle, le conseiller expert ne se déclenche que sur les ticks du graphique où il est chargé.
2. Il s'agit d'un script de démonstration. La boucle est nécessaire pour vérifier la capacité de travail pendant le week-end.

3. fonctionnera.

Merci beaucoup, Vadim !